Transaction 5d3407e7aa534eaf5c9a7cc07fc079c53d0af12169f8790cb57c64f91b71cc58

block
78be9657b04c86fa310d36a9906f2d81c7a0740a5a342a16c51183f540f7cbf3

1 Input

97 Outputs